Size: a a a

2020 June 14

AK

Andy Korg in Delphi & Lazarus
Nik
оно будет таким же полем внутри uas_users_identityfield
Не понял, это же сами поля.
источник

N

Nik in Delphi & Lazarus
значения полей лежат в UAS_USERS_IDENTITY
источник

N

Nik in Delphi & Lazarus
я лентяй и не хочу 100500 таблиц создавать.. я буду интерфейс пользователя генерировать по описанию из БД
источник

AK

Andy Korg in Delphi & Lazarus
Nik
значения полей лежат в UAS_USERS_IDENTITY
Ага, понятно. Т.е можно будет держать два поля с одинаковым именем IsActive, но в одном написать "False",  а в другом "Уволен" ?
источник

N

Nik in Delphi & Lazarus
Захочется мне добавить кликуху пользователя в базу - я тупо добавлю в справочник новое описание поля "кликуха" и оно у меня отобразится в интерфейсе пользователя
источник

N

Nik in Delphi & Lazarus
Andy Korg
Ага, понятно. Т.е можно будет держать два поля с одинаковым именем IsActive, но в одном написать "False",  а в другом "Уволен" ?
внутри классов делфийских есть список обязательных полей, которые должны быть в этом справочнике
источник

N

Nik in Delphi & Lazarus
инициализироваться таблица со списком полей будет при запуске программы
источник

AK

Andy Korg in Delphi & Lazarus
Nik
инициализироваться таблица со списком полей будет при запуске программы
"Инициализироваться" в смысле создаваться или наполняться описаниям полей?
источник

И

Илья in Delphi & Lazarus
Nik
я лентяй и не хочу 100500 таблиц создавать.. я буду интерфейс пользователя генерировать по описанию из БД
Потом, чтобы вывести всех пользователей со всеми доп. полями(свойствами) придется писать много LEFT JOIN.
источник

N

Nik in Delphi & Lazarus
почему так? потому что я не знаю на данный момент какие поля потребуются другим провайдерам аутентификации, которые я в дальнейшем буду подключать к программе
источник

N

Nik in Delphi & Lazarus
Andy Korg
"Инициализироваться" в смысле создаваться или наполняться описаниям полей?
и то, и то если потребуется
источник

N

Nik in Delphi & Lazarus
моя ОРМ умеет всё это
источник

N

Nik in Delphi & Lazarus
она из существующей БД умеет генерировать pas-исходники
источник

N

Nik in Delphi & Lazarus
и SQL-скрипты создания/апдейта тоже умеет генерировать
источник

N

Nik in Delphi & Lazarus
Илья
Потом, чтобы вывести всех пользователей со всеми доп. полями(свойствами) придется писать много LEFT JOIN.
зачем? там один join будет
источник

N

Nik in Delphi & Lazarus
если надо какие-то поля не отображать, то просто прописываешь их в where
источник

И

Игорь in Delphi & Lazarus
Nik
и SQL-скрипты создания/апдейта тоже умеет генерировать
круто!
источник

Miss Очепятка... in Delphi & Lazarus
Такой вопрос есть многопоточное приложение. Зависает на
источник

Miss Очепятка... in Delphi & Lazarus
procedure TWinControl.Update;
begin
 if HandleAllocated then UpdateWindow(FHandle);
end;
источник

Miss Очепятка... in Delphi & Lazarus
Вопрос в чём может быть проблема?
источник